Sony’s Purchase of Gaikai for $380 Million

Sony purchased Gaikai for a sum of $380 million. Gaikai was making deals with Samsung to extend the service directly onto televisions and extending it’s presence. It’s possible that Sony was given a similar offer; Sony saw a bigger picture and purchased them instead. The Gaikai service could be re-branded as the new PSN, PlayStation Network powered by Gaikai and add instant gaming experiences to just about any machine running a web browser. Plus, consumers could then buy a game and play it instantly online.



A Gaikai app could be used to bypass the PS3′s limited ram

It has been well documented that the PS3 has limited RAM for the OS. Instead of running it through the browser, Sony could release a Gaikai app for the PS3 similar to that of Netflix or Hulu. Bypass the browser, solve the problem, the hardware could still be used without being upgraded. This extends the longevity of the current consoles and keeps them relevant. If the power of the next PlayStation is really as amazing as being boasted, then that would be expensive to produce, and the longer they wait, the price of the parts decrease. They save more money the longer they wait.
